For the U.S.’s 250th Birthday, a German Declaration of Independence Goes on Show

To celebrate the U.S.’s 250th anniversary, Berlin is showcasing an original German translation of the Declaration of Independence, highlighting a unique piece of shared history between the U.S. and Germany.
